Not exactly fact.

Currently Maryland has 39 on the roster which is above their norm.

Lets take a look at the freshmen classes form 2016 and 2017 and see how they have done.

Below is Freshmen Class of 2016. 9 Freshmen (7 were Under Armor All-American, 2 were not)


---------------------Freshmen 2016-----------------
-----------Under Armor All-Americans and how they did at Maryland----------

Megan Taylor..............DIAll-American - Tewaaraton Award - National Player of the Year.
Julia Braig...................DI All-American - National Defender of the Year.
Caroline Steele...........DI All-American
Shelby Mercer.............DI All-American
Jen Giles.....................DI All-American
Megan Doherty:..........Starts Every Game
Kelsey Cummings.......Reserve Player

--------------Non-Under Armour AA's and how they did--------

Marissa Donoghue..........Plays in just about Every Game So, Jr, Sr years.
Katherine Golladay..........Reserve Player



Below is Freshmen class of 2017. 9 Freshmen (6 were Under Armour All-Americans , 3 were not)


----------------------Freshmen 2017-----------------------
-----------Under Armor All-Americans - Current Seniors and how they have done so far-------

Kali Hartshorn..................DI All-American.
Lizzi Colson......................DI All-American.
Brindi Griffin.....................NCAA All-Tournament Team - started and or played every game for 4 years.
Hannah Warther................Played in every game in 2019 - missed 2018 injury.
Natalie Miller.....................Has been a reserve player.
Niki Sliwak........................Has been a reserve player.

--------------Non-Under Armor AA's-----------------

Julia Salandra.....................Has been a reserve player.
Andrea Mctaggart...............Has been a reserve player.
Victoria L'insalata................Has been a reserve player.

Total 18 Recruits over two years. 13 were Under Armour All-Americans (or as you say superstars).

Out of the 13 superstars:

7 Became Division I All-Americans (including a Tewaaraton, Player of the Year and The National Defender of the Year).
4 Played in just about every game (including one who made the NCAA All-Tournament team and another who made the IL All-Rookie team).
3 reserve players.

Out of the 5 non-superstars:

1 became a regular player.
4 reserve players.

By the way.... Every single one of those players is either still playing or graduated last year after four years of playing No, 50% did not quit.
By the way.... Most of the "superstars" did not ride the bench or disappear in college.
